Author Biography
Allen C. Guelzo is Henry R. Luce Professor of the Civil War Era and Director of Civil War Era Studies at Gettysburg College. Three-time winner of the Lincoln Prize, he is the author of Abraham Lincoln: Redeemer President, Lincoln's Emancipation Proclamation: The End of Slavery in America, Lincoln: A Very Short Introduction, Fateful Lightning: A New History of the Civil War and Reconstruction, and Gettysburg: The Last Invasion, which won the Guggenheim-Lehrman Prize in Military History.
